In 1883, Bertha M Hammond entered the world in Perry County, Pennsylvania, USA, born to Clinton E Hammond And Ida Sophia Tyrrell. In 1900, Bertha M Hammond resided in Occoquan, Prince William, Virginia, USA. In 1902, Bertha M Hammond resided in 402 Third Avenue , Hampden. Bertha M Hammond married Edgar Calvin Decker, William Alexander Ball, and had children including Lillian Decker, Pauline Ida Virginia Decker, William G Ball. Bertha M Hammond passed away in 1938 in Baltimore, Baltimore City, Maryland, USA.
